WPP Media in London is looking for an Associate Director in Global Commercial to drive the commercial success of international contracts. This role involves leading negotiations, building strong client relationships, and managing a portfolio of clients while ensuring contract compliance.

Candidates should have a bachelor's degree and experience in commercial management within the media sector. Benefits include competitive medical plans and significant paid time off. Must have the right to work in the UK.

How to prepare for a job interview at WPP Media

✨Know Your Numbers

As a candidate for the Global Commercial Lead role, it's crucial to come prepared with data that showcases your past successes in revenue growth and negotiations. Be ready to discuss specific figures and outcomes from previous contracts you've managed.

✨Understand the Media Landscape

Familiarise yourself with current trends and challenges in the media sector. This knowledge will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also demonstrate your genuine interest in the industry and how you can contribute to WPP Media's success.

✨Build Rapport with Interviewers

Since this role involves building strong client relationships, show your interpersonal skills during the interview. Engage with your interviewers, ask insightful questions, and listen actively to their responses. This will reflect your ability to connect with clients.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your negotiation skills and contract management experience. Think of examples where you've successfully navigated complex negotiations or resolved compliance issues, and be ready to share these stories in detail.
